This is the playable demo for Gemini Rue, an independently developed adventure game set in a dark futuristic sci-fi world.

"Gemini Rue is a gripping adventure set in a bleak future dominated by the corrupt Boryokudan crime syndicate. Alternating between two characters, ex-assassin Azriel Odin and hospital inmate Delta-Six, players must uncover the secrets both men are hiding and discover the bond between them. Inspired by the old-school adventure games of Sierra and LucasArts, Gemini Rue features a point and click interface, hand-painted backgrounds, professional voice acting, an original soundtrack, and optional in-game commentary."

Gemini Rue announced; due for release February 24

A game that started out as a student project is getting a downloadable commercial release next month. Gemini Rue, a sci-fi themed point-and-click adventure game, will be released by publisher Wadjet Eye Games on February 24. The game was originally titled Boryokudan Rue and was first created by UCLA undergraduate Joshua Nuernberger. Under its previous name the game was a finalist for the Independent Games Festival's Student Showcase division in 2010.

The game itself will have players controlling two characters; a ex-assassin named Azriel Odin and a man with no memory and known as "Delta-Six". Pre-orders for the game have begun with the downloadable version available for $14.99. You can also get a mail order CD version for $29.99 that also includes the downloadable version, plus a developer commentary and MP3 soundtrack.
